The 2005 Crozes Hermitage Blanc Clos des Grives is still fresh and lively, with a certain umami-like quality in its citron, saffron, caramelized lemons and smoky aromas and flavors. Still lively and fresh on the palate, with bright acidity and plenty of texture, it shows how well this cuvée ages. I don’t see any upside to holding bottles, but I suspect it will continue drinking nicely for at least 2-3 years.
